Transaction d531cda76626cbcb9b281f46221a4a9a2c1bffb8db86a48decb53f084d0ae838
1 Input
1 Output
-
d531cda76626cbcb9b281f46221a4a9a2c1bffb8db86a48decb53f084d0ae838:0
- value
- 21899078
- script pubkey
- OP_0 OP_PUSHBYTES_20 e676349e788bc097e2e8559cf91523552e2deee8
- address
- bc1quemrf8nc30qf0chg2kw0j9fr25hzmmhgg4kctk